- Summary:
- In this literary smackdown, one giant of American literature thoroughly demolishes the literary output of another. With his trademark plainspoken wit, Mark Twain presents a catalog of everything he hates about the work of James Fenimore Cooper, author of such classics as The Last of the Mohicans . Whether you're Team Twain or Team Fenimore Cooper, you're sure to be entertained by this cutting takedown.
